Contract surety bond programs help contractors qualify for project obligations by reviewing business experience, financial standing, work in progress, bonding history, and contracting specialty.
Performance bonds guarantee completion of contracted work and require detailed project information, including obligee, contract amount, bond penalty, job location, and contract timeline.

Getting bonded in Delaware starts with confirming the exact bond requirement, including the obligee, required bond amount, and any specific bond form language. You will then need to provide company and owner details such as your legal business name, entity type, address, tax ID, contact information, and ownership details. Depending on the bond amount, a credit review may be required. Once underwriting is complete and the bond is approved, it is issued and delivered so you can submit it to the appropriate licensing office, county, or municipality.
